1. What Are Cookies?

Cookies are small text files placed on your device when you visit a website. They are widely used to make websites work more efficiently and to provide information to the website owner.

Cookies may be set by the website you are visiting (first-party cookies) or by third-party services operating on that site (third-party cookies).

3.2 Analytics Cookies

These cookies help us understand how visitors use our website by collecting anonymous statistical information.

Cookie name Provider Purpose Duration Type
_ga Google Analytics Registers a unique ID for statistical data 2 years Third-party
_ga_* Google Analytics Used to persist session state 2 years Third-party
_gid Google Analytics Registers a unique ID for statistical data 24 hours Third-party
_gat Google Analytics Used to throttle request rate 1 minute Third-party
